"VTOTICE is hereby given that I have appointed TUESDAY, March 10th 1885, the day on which a poll shall be taken upon the proposal of tie Masterton Borough Council to raise the sum of TEN THOUSAND POUNDS, (£10,000) by way of special loan. for. the purpose of constructing GAS WORKS, The said poll shall be taken at the INSTITUTE, Masterton, between the hours of 9 in the forenoon and 0 in the afternoon of the day appointed, M, CASELBERG, ' Mayor.
